in this video you will see how to edit footer in PPT in PowerPoint you can edit the footer by clicking on the footer and then type what you want however the change made in the footer will be applicable to only that slide if you want to change the footer on all the slides in Powerpoint then you need to click here on the insert tab and you will see the option of header and footer you can edit the footer using this option just click on it and you will see this header and footer window if you already have a footer you will see the footer is on and the text type in the footer so if you want to change footer on all the slides for example letamp;#39;s say we will type here PowerPoint footer and you need to click on apply all to make changes to all the slides and if you click on apply the change will be made to the current slide only so after clicking on apply to all if you go to the next slide as you can see here the PowerPoint has automatically updated the new footer on the new slide so if

On the View tab, click Slide Master. At the top of the thumbnail pane, click the slide master to select it. Highlight any footer elements (such as date, footer text, or slide number) on the slide master, and then on the Home tab, choose the font formatting you want in the Font and Paragraph groups.
How to remove footer in PowerPoint Step 1: Open Your PowerPoint Presentation. Step 2: Access the Slide Master View. Step 3: Locate the Footer Placeholder. Step 4: Delete or Modify the Footer Elements. Step 5: Apply Changes and Exit Slide Master View.
To remove embedded fonts (Windows): Open the PowerPoint file on your computer. On the File menu, select Options and then in the left column, select the Save tab. At the bottom, under Preserve fidelity when sharing this presentation, clear the Embed fonts in the file check box. Save the file, then close and re-open it.
Click the View tab. In the Master Views group, click Slide Master. In the slide thumbnail pane, make sure you select the thumbnail at the top, with a number near the top-left corner. Select the picture you want to delete, and press Delete.
Click INSERT Header Footer. Click the Slide tab, make the changes you want, and click either Apply to apply the changes to the selected slides, or Apply to All to make the changes to all the slides.
How do you unlock the footer in PowerPoint? Click the Header Footer button in the center of the ribbon. Uncheck the box to the left of Footer. Click Apply to All.
Click the line, connector, or shape that you want to delete, and then press Delete. If you want to delete multiple lines or connectors, select the first line, press and hold Ctrl while you select the other lines, and then press Delete.
